Sheetster
Sheetster is a GPL open-source Web Spreadsheet and a Java Application Server created by Extentech Inc. The product was created for the enterprise and small and medium-sized businesses as an Open Source alternative to closed document management systems.
History
Built by Extentech Inc, a developer of Java spreadsheet and development tools, Sheetster BETA was made available to the public on June 8, 2007.Features
- Output to PDF
- Total Compatibility with Excel 1997–2007 Files
- Embed YouTube videos in your Spreadsheets
- Publish Spreadsheets as RSS with R3S
- Instant Web2.0 Apps with Forms, Charts, and Macros
- Role-based security and sharing
Sheetster Web Spreadsheet | ExtenXLS Java Spreadsheet SDK | Cellbinder Automation API | Spreadsheet Automation Server |
Source Included/GPL | Customizable Java Swing GUI | REST API JSON/XML/HTML/CSV/XLS output | Object-Relational Mapper and Query Builder |
Document chat | Named ranges | Secure content management system | Embeddable live data charts |
Macros, forms, and gadgets for web 2.0 database applications | Excel 2007 compatibility | Data Mapping API | Collaboration, versioning, and access control |
The Sheetster administration console allows for the design of relational data objects using a visual query designer and object-relational mapper. The RESTful API accepts data from a variety of sources, and outputs data-mapped spreadsheet objects in a variety of formats including JSON, XML, and as Excel-compatible XLS.
Sheetster can be automated with macros and automatic data entry forms created from Excel cell ranges. Data Objects can be mapped to spreadsheet templates and output in a variety of formats:
- Excel 2007 Spreadsheet
- Excel Binary Spreadsheet CSV
- ExtenXLS XML Doc
- Archive All Spreadsheets
- XSLT Transform
- CSV
Usage
- As a hosted web spreadsheet:
- As a web service embedded within other applications
- Spreadsheet calculations—used as secure formula engines within Web 2.0 and traditional client-server web applications.
Storage
- SaaS online access
- Local host server for offline access
- Behind the firewall
- On Amazon S3
Integration
Integration is achieved through the RESTful API which allows for publishing of data-mapped spreadsheet cells as web services. Sheetster provides integrated support for:- Advanced server-based spreadsheet automation and functionality
- A REST API with JSON/XML/HTML/CSV/ and XLS output
- Sheetster Web Spreadsheet
- Built-in secure content management system
- ExtenXLS Java Spreadsheet SDK
- Customizable Java Swing administration GUI with Object-Relational Mapper and Query Builder